>Maybe I got a bargain, maybe I didn't. Help me decide. I won an
auction
>for three paper tapes in excellent condition. All three are labeled
with a
>DECUS sticker (and the main DECUS site is re-organizinf its software
>section, so there's no info there). All three have typewritten
RSTS11-75 on
>them, then one has 8080.Bas 2/June/76, one has 8008.Bas 2/June/76, and
the
>third has 8008.Doc 2/June/76. Supposedly these all came from MITS.


??? MITS had nothing to do with DEC or RSTS11 OS. So my guess is they
were user submissions of some basic programs not the MITS basic
(billy gates would have fits over that one too). Also MITS never did
anything
with 8008 that I ever heard of.

>So, for starters, does anyone KNOW what these are? Any informed guesses
>beyond the obvious? Can anyone read them for me or make copies in a
more
>"modern" format (i.e., CUTS cassette tape)?


Well the .bas suggest they could be basic but are they tokenized or
ascii???
